在移动互联网时代,小程序以其轻量级、无需下载安装、即用即走的特点,迅速成为连接用户与服务的重要桥梁。无论是电商、餐饮、教育还是娱乐行业,小程序都展现出了巨大的商业价值。然而,面对众多的小程序开发框架,如何高效开发并选择合适的框架,成为了众多开发者关注的焦点。本文将为你揭秘如何挑选最适合自己的小程序开发框架,助力你快速构建出优质的小程序。


一、明确开发需求,定位框架选择方向

在选择小程序开发框架之前,首先要明确自己的开发需求。不同的开发需求对应着不同的开发框架。例如,如果你需要开发一个简单的社交类小程序,微信小程序原生框架会是一个不错的选择,因为它提供了丰富的组件和API,能够快速构建出符合微信生态的小程序。而如果你需要开发一个跨平台的小程序,那么uni-app、Taro等框架则更适合,因为它们支持一次编写代码,多端发布。

二、评估框架性能,确保高效运行

性能是评估小程序开发框架的重要指标之一。一个高效的开发框架应该具备稳定的性能,能够确保小程序在各种环境下都能流畅运行。在选择框架时,可以关注其官方文档或社区中的性能评测数据,了解其在处理复杂逻辑、渲染页面等方面的表现。同时,也可以参考其他开发者的使用体验,了解框架在实际应用中的性能表现。

三、考察框架集成性,提升开发效率

良好的集成性是选择小程序开发框架时需要考虑的另一个重要因素。一个优秀的框架应该能够与其他开发工具或平台进行无缝集成,从而提升开发效率。例如,微信小程序原生框架可以与微信开发者工具紧密集成,提供代码编辑、预览、调试等一站式开发体验。而uni-app等跨平台框架则支持将代码编译成多个平台的小程序,减少了重复开发的工作量。

四、关注社区支持,获取持续帮助

一个优秀的开发框架往往拥有庞大的社区支持。社区中的开发者可以为你提供丰富的教程、示例代码和解决方案,帮助你快速上手并解决开发中遇到的问题。在选择框架时,可以关注其官方社区、GitHub仓库、论坛等渠道,了解社区的活跃度和支持情况。同时,也可以参与社区中的讨论和分享,与其他开发者交流心得和经验。

五、考虑团队能力,选择适合的开发框架

团队能力也是选择小程序开发框架时需要考虑的因素之一。如果团队成员熟悉某个特定的开发框架,那么选择该框架可以提高开发效率和质量。同时,还需要考虑团队成员的技术水平,选择适合自己团队能力的框架可以避免技术难题的出现。在选择框架时,可以与团队成员进行充分沟通和讨论,共同确定最适合的开发框架。

六、参考成功案例,了解框架实际应用

通过查看其他开发者使用某个框架开发的成功案例,可以了解该框架在实际应用中的表现和优势。这些成功案例不仅可以为你提供灵感和借鉴,还可以帮助你更好地评估框架的适用性和可靠性。在选择框架时,可以搜索相关的成功案例和评测文章,了解不同框架在实际应用中的表现和特点。

七、具体框架推荐及费用说明

  1. 微信小程序原生框架
    • 优势:提供丰富的组件和API,与微信生态紧密集成,适合开发社交、电商等微信生态内的小程序。
    • 费用:免费使用,但需支付微信认证费用(300元/年)。
  2. uni-app
    • 优势:支持一次编写代码,多端发布(包括微信小程序、支付宝小程序、H5等),提供丰富的组件和插件。
    • 费用:基础功能免费使用,部分高级功能和插件可能需要付费购买。
  3. Taro
    • 优势:遵循React语法规范,支持多端开发,提供开箱即用的语法检测和自动补全等功能。
    • 费用:免费使用,但需自行承担服务器和域名等费用。
  4. mpvue
    • 优势:基于Vue.js核心,支持组件化开发,适合熟悉Vue.js的开发者使用。
    • 费用:免费使用,但需自行承担服务器和域名等费用。

结语:高效开发,从选择合适的框架开始

选择合适的小程序开发框架是高效开发的关键。通过明确开发需求、评估框架性能、考察框架集成性、关注社区支持、考虑团队能力以及参考成功案例等方法,你可以找到最适合自己的小程序开发框架。同时,也需要注意不同框架的优缺点和费用情况,以便做出更加明智的选择。在未来的小程序开发中,让我们携手共进,共同创造更加美好的移动互联世界!

 

扫描下方二维码,一个老毕登免费为你解答更多软件开发疑问!

小程序电商:打造无缝购物体验的关键(如何通过小程序电商打造无缝购物体验)

在移动互联网时代,小程序电商以其便捷性、即用即走的特点,迅速成为消费者青睐的购物方式。为了在这场没有硝烟的电商大战中脱颖而出,打造无缝购物体验成为了小程序电商的制胜法宝。本文将为您深入剖析如何通过小程序电商打造无缝购物体验,助您在激烈的市场竞争中占据先机。一、优化界面设计,提升用户视觉体验小程序电商的界面设计是用户接触的第一道门槛,直接影响用户的购物体验和购买决策。因此,优化界面设计,提升用户视觉

制作小程序需要掌握哪些前端技术?(前端技术大揭秘,助力小程序开发)

在移动互联网的浪潮中,小程序以其轻量级、便捷性和无需下载安装的特点,迅速成为连接用户与服务的重要桥梁。对于想要开发小程序的前端开发者来说,掌握一系列关键的前端技术至关重要。今天,我们就来一起揭秘那些助力小程序开发的前端技术,让你在开发之路上如鱼得水!一、小程序开发框架:掌握核心,事半功倍小程序开发通常依赖于特定的框架,比如微信小程序就使用其独有的WXML(WeiXin Markup Languag

制作小程序有哪些流行的设计风格?(紧跟潮流,打造时尚小程序界面)

在移动互联网飞速发展的今天,小程序已经成为连接用户与服务的重要桥梁。而一个时尚、吸引人的小程序界面设计,不仅能够提升用户体验,还能在众多竞争者中脱颖而出。那么,制作小程序时,哪些设计风格最流行呢?今天,就让我们一起揭秘这些紧跟潮流的设计风格,让你的小程序界面瞬间焕发时尚魅力!一、简约清新风:以简洁之美赢得用户心简约清新风,以其简洁明了、色彩柔和的特点,深受用户喜爱。这种设计风格强调“少即是多”,通

制作小程序有哪些常见的安全漏洞?(安全漏洞需警惕,防范于未然)

在移动互联网时代,小程序以其便捷、无需下载的特点,迅速成为用户喜爱的应用形式。然而,随着小程序市场的蓬勃发展,其安全问题也日益凸显。今天,小编就来为大家盘点一下制作小程序时常见的安全漏洞,并分享一些实用的防范措施,帮助大家将安全隐患扼杀在摇篮里!1. 源代码泄露风险小程序的本质是网页交互,其通讯更容易被破解。由于小程序源码难以混淆加密,导致山寨仿冒小程序大量出现。这些山寨小程序不仅侵犯了正版小程序

微信小程序

微信扫一扫体验

微信公众账号

微信扫一扫加关注

发表
评论
返回
顶部